Home directory for Malawi's wwwroot
Duncan Ewan
2021-02-19 3e758c29e0fde36fc088efcfc88f9a3014432b64
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
Êþº¾-8
SourceFileB/app/coldfusion10/cfusion/wwwroot/acc/components/alarm_filters.cfc1cfalarm_filters2ecfc242878451$funcGETKPIENGINEERScoldfusion/runtime/UDFMethod<init>()V 
    com.adobe.coldfusion.* bindImportPath(Ljava/lang/String;)V coldfusion/runtime/CfJspPage
coldfusion/util/Key    ARGUMENTSLcoldfusion/util/Key;      bindInternalF(Lcoldfusion/util/Key;Ljava/lang/Object;)Lcoldfusion/runtime/Variable; coldfusion/runtime/LocalScope
THIS      RESULT"1(Ljava/lang/String;)Lcoldfusion/runtime/Variable; $
%ENGINEER'FILTERGROUPLIST) pageContext#Lcoldfusion/runtime/NeoPageContext; +,    -getOut()Ljavax/servlet/jsp/JspWriter; /0javax/servlet/jsp/JspContext2
31parentLjavax/servlet/jsp/tagext/Tag; 56    7 FILTERGROUPID9string; getVariable (I)Lcoldfusion/runtime/Variable; =>%coldfusion/runtime/ArgumentCollection@
A? _validateArga(Ljava/lang/String;ZLjava/lang/String;Lcoldfusion/runtime/Variable;)Lcoldfusion/runtime/Variable; CD
EFILTERIDGSHIFTIget(I)Ljava/lang/Object; KL
AMHISTORYO0Qput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; ST
AU
START_DATEWEND_DATEY
 
        [ _whitespace%(Ljava/io/Writer;Ljava/lang/String;)V ]^
__setCurrentLineNo(I)V ab
c    StructNew!()Lcoldfusion/util/FastHashtable; efcoldfusion/runtime/CFPageh
igset(Ljava/lang/Object;)V klcoldfusion/runtime/Variablen
om
 
        q___IMPLICITARRYSTRUCTVAR2sArrayNew(I)Ljava/util/List; uv
iwjava/lang/Objecty    engineers{_autoscalarize1(Lcoldfusion/runtime/Variable;)Ljava/lang/Object; }~
 _arraySetAtE(Lcoldfusion/runtime/Variable;[Ljava/lang/Object;Ljava/lang/Object;)V ‚
ƒsuccess…true‡*coldfusion/runtime/TransientVariableHolder‰&(Lcoldfusion/runtime/NeoPageContext;)V ‹
ŠŒ
            ŽGETKPIFILTERGROUPSLIST_get&(Ljava/lang/String;)Ljava/lang/Object; ’“
”getKPIFilterGroupsList–
_invokeUDFf(Ljava/lang/Object;Ljava/lang/String;Lcoldfusion/runtime/CFPage;[Ljava/lang/Object;)Ljava/lang/Object; ˜™
š$class$coldfusion$tagext$sql$QueryTagLjava/lang/Class;coldfusion.tagext.sql.QueryTagžforName%(Ljava/lang/String;)Ljava/lang/Class;  ¡java/lang/Class£
¤¢ œ    ¦_initTagP(Ljava/lang/Class;ILjavax/servlet/jsp/tagext/Tag;)Ljavax/servlet/jsp/tagext/Tag; ¨©
ªcoldfusion/tagext/sql/QueryTag¬cfquery®name°qryGetKPIEngineers²_validateTagAttrValue\(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;)Ljava/lang/String; ´µ
¶setName ¸
­¹
datasource» APPLICATION½java/lang/String¿DBCONNÁ_resolveAndAutoscalarize9(Ljava/lang/String;[Ljava/lang/String;)Ljava/lang/Object; ÃÄ
Å\(Ljava/lang/String;Ljava/lang/String;Ljava/lang/Object;Ljava/lang/String;)Ljava/lang/Object; ´Ç
È setDatasource Êl
­ËtimeoutÍSHORTDBQUERYTIMEOUTÏ_int(Ljava/lang/Object;)I ÑÒcoldfusion/runtime/CastÔ
ÕÓ:(Ljava/lang/String;Ljava/lang/String;ILjava/lang/String;)I ´×
Ø
setTimeout Úb
­Û    hasEndTag(Z)V ÝÞcoldfusion/tagext/GenericTagà
áß
doStartTag()I ãä
­å    _pushBody_(Ljavax/servlet/jsp/tagext/BodyTag;ILjavax/servlet/jsp/JspWriter;)Ljavax/servlet/jsp/JspWriter; çè
él
                SELECT DISTINCT engineer_user_name username, engineer_full_name fullname
                ëwrite íjava/io/Writerï
ðîD(Lcoldfusion/runtime/Variable;[Ljava/lang/String;)Ljava/lang/Object; Ãò
ó_compare(Ljava/lang/Object;D)D õö
÷e
                    FROM kpi_shift_cfg_current
                    WHERE 1=1
                    ù1
                        and filtergroup_id in (û)class$coldfusion$tagext$sql$QueryParamTag#coldfusion.tagext.sql.QueryParamTagþ ý    #coldfusion/tagext/sql/QueryParamTag cfqueryparam    cfsqltypecf_sql_numeric setCfsqltype 
 
 value setValue l
list_boolean(Ljava/lang/String;)Z 
Õ:(Ljava/lang/String;Ljava/lang/String;ZLjava/lang/String;)Z ´
setList Þ
nullLen  Ò
i!(D)Z #
Õ$_Object(Z)Ljava/lang/Object; &'
Õ( YesNoFormat&(Ljava/lang/Object;)Ljava/lang/String; *+
i,setNull .Þ
/ _emptyTcfTag!(Ljavax/servlet/jsp/tagext/Tag;)Z 12
3)
                    5/
                        AND filtergroup_id = 7
                    9*
                        AND filter_id = ;ALL='(Ljava/lang/Object;Ljava/lang/String;)D õ?
@&
                        AND shift = Bcf_sql_varcharDC
                    ORDER BY engineer_full_name
                Fb
                    FROM kpi_ipf_counters
                    WHERE TRUNC(shift_start) BETWEEN H cf_sql_dateJ AND L0
                        AND filter_group_id = N®
                    UNION
                    SELECT 'ALL', '--- All Engineers ---'
                    FROM dual
                    ORDER BY fullname
                P doAfterBody Rä
­S_popBody=(ILjavax/servlet/jsp/JspWriter;)Ljavax/servlet/jsp/JspWriter; UV
WdoEndTag Yä
­ZdoCatch(Ljava/lang/Throwable;)V \]
­^    doFinally `
­a
 
            c$class$coldfusion$tagext$lang$LoopTagcoldfusion.tagext.lang.LoopTagf e    hcoldfusion/tagext/lang/LoopTagjcflooplquerynsetQuery plcoldfusion/tagext/QueryLoopr
sq
kå
                vusernamexQRYGETKPIENGINEERSzUSERNAME|fullname~FULLNAME€
 
                ‚ _arrayGetAtC(Lcoldfusion/runtime/Variable;Ljava/lang/Object;)Ljava/lang/Object; „…
†_List$(Ljava/lang/Object;)Ljava/util/List; ˆ‰
ÕŠ ArrayAppend%(Ljava/util/List;Ljava/lang/Object;)Z Œ
iŽ
kS
kZ
s^
kaunwrap,(Ljava/lang/Throwable;)Ljava/lang/Throwable; ”•coldfusion/runtime/NeoException—
˜–t0[Ljava/lang/String;anyœ š›    žfindThrowableTarget+(Ljava/lang/Throwable;[Ljava/lang/String;)I  ¡
˜¢CFCATCH¤bind'(Ljava/lang/String;Ljava/lang/Object;)V ¦§
Ѝfalseªerror¬ }“
®unbind °
б
    ³getKPIEngineersµmetaDataLjava/lang/Object; ·¸    ¹struct»&coldfusion/runtime/AttributeCollection½
returntype¿ returnformatÁjsonÃaccessÅremoteÇhintÉRetrieves standby shiftsË
ParametersÍNAMEÏ filterGroupIdÑTYPEÓREQUIREDÕyes×([Ljava/lang/Object;)V Ù
¾ÚfilterIdÜshiftÞhistoryàDEFAULTânoä
start_dateæend_dateèthis3Lcfalarm_filters2ecfc242878451$funcGETKPIENGINEERS;LocalVariableTableCode getParamList()[Ljava/lang/String; runFunction‡(Lcoldfusion/runtime/LocalScope;Ljava/lang/Object;Lcoldfusion/runtime/CFPage;Lcoldfusion/runtime/ArgumentCollection;)Ljava/lang/Object; __localScopeLcoldfusion/runtime/LocalScope;instance
parentPageLcoldfusion/runtime/CFPage; __arguments'Lcoldfusion/runtime/ArgumentCollection;outLjavax/servlet/jsp/JspWriter;Lcoldfusion/runtime/Variable;t20,Lcoldfusion/runtime/TransientVariableHolder;query61 Lcoldfusion/tagext/sql/QueryTag;mode61I queryparam52%Lcoldfusion/tagext/sql/QueryParamTag;t24 queryparam53t26 queryparam54t28 queryparam55t30 queryparam56t32 queryparam57t34 queryparam58t36 queryparam59t38 queryparam60t40t41Ljava/lang/Throwable;t42t43t44t45t46loop62 Lcoldfusion/tagext/lang/LoopTag;mode62t49t50t51t52t53#Lcoldfusion/runtime/AbortException;t54Ljava/lang/Exception;__cfcatchThrowable6t56t57LineNumberTablejava/lang/Throwable+!coldfusion/runtime/AbortException-java/lang/Exception/<clinit>getName()Ljava/lang/String; getReturnType    getAccess getMetadata()Ljava/lang/Object;1œýeš›·¸í#*·
±ì êëîïíB$½ÀY:SYHSYJSYPSYXSYZS°ì $êëðñíP    :    P- ¶+²¶:+²!,¶:    +#¶&:
+(¶&: +*¶&: -´.¶4:-´8:*:<¶B¶F: *H<¶B¶F:*J<¶B¶F:¶N¦ PR¶VW*P<¶B¶F:¶N¦ XR¶VW*X<¶B¶F:¶N¦ ZR¶VW*Z<¶B¶F:-\¶`
-„¶d¸j¶p-r¶`+t¶&:-¶x¶p-
½zY|S-¶€¶„-r¶`-
½zY†Sˆ¶„-\¶`»ŠY-´.·:-¶` -‰¶d-‘¶•—-½z¸›¶p-¶`-²§¶«À­:-жd¯±³¸·¶º¯¼-¾½ÀYÂS¶Æ¸É¶Ì¯Î-¾½ÀYÐS¶Æ¸Ö¸Ù¶Ü¶â¶æY6™K-¶ê:ì¶ñ-½ÀYPS¶ô¸ø—špú¶ñ-½ÀY:S¶ô¸ø—š¸ü¶ñ-²¶«À:-¶d    ¸·¶ - ¶€¸É¶ˆ¸¸¶-¶d-¶d- ¶€¸"‡¸%‚¸)¸-¸¸¶0¶â¸4™:¨R¨¨J°6¶ñ§w8¶ñ-²¶«À:-’¶d    ¸·¶ -½ÀY:S¶ô¸É¶¶â¸4™:¨ܨ¨Ô°-:¶`-:¶`-¶€¸ø—™w<¶ñ-²¶«À:-•¶d    ¸·¶ -½ÀYHS¶ô¸É¶¶â¸4™:¨P¨¨H°-:¶`-:¶`-¶€>¸A—™wC¶ñ-²¶«À:-˜¶dE¸·¶ -½ÀYJS¶ô¸É¶¶â¸4™:¨¨ÿ¨º°-:¶`G¶ñ§‡I¶ñ-²¶«À:-¶dK¸·¶ -½ÀYXS¶ô¸É¶¶â¸4™: ¨C¨€¨; °M¶ñ-²¶«À:!-¶d!K¸·¶ !-½ÀYZS¶ô¸É¶!¶â!¸4™:"¨ب¨Ð"°-:¶`- ¶€¸ø—™wO¶ñ-²¶«À:#-Ÿ¶d#    ¸·¶ #-½ÀY:S¶ô¸É¶#¶â#¸4™:$¨U¨’¨M$°-:¶`-:¶`-¶€¸ø—™w<¶ñ-²¶«À:%-¢¶d%    ¸·¶ %-½ÀYHS¶ô¸É¶%¶â%¸4™:&¨É¨¨Á&°-:¶`-:¶`-¶€>¸A—™wC¶ñ-²¶«À:'-¥¶d'E¸·¶ '-½ÀYJS¶ô¸É¶'¶â'¸4™:(¨;¨x¨3(°-:¶`Q¶ñ-¶`¶Tšú㨧:)¨)¿:*-¶X:©*¶[ :+¨&¨á+°¨§#:,,¶_¨§:-¨-¿:.¶b©.-d¶`-²i¶«Àk:/-®¶d/mo³¸É¶t/¶â/¶uY60™¥-w¶` -¯¶d¸j¶p-w¶`- ½zYyS-{½ÀY}S¶Æ¶„-w¶`- ½zYS-{½ÀYS¶Æ¶„-ƒ¶`-³¶d--
|¶‡¸‹- ¶€¶W-¶`/¶šÿa/¶‘ :1¨&¨Ã1°¨§#:2/2¶’¨§:3¨3¿:4/¶“©4-d¶`¨Ž§”:55¿:66¸™:77²Ÿ¸£ªa¥7¶©-w¶`-
½zY†S«¶„-w¶`-
½zY­S-¥¶¯¶„-¶`§6¿¨§:8¨8¿:9¶²©9-\¶`-
¶€°-´¶`°Oõã',éY',_å',ës',yò',ø]',cà',æl',rú',$',',',êãX,éYX,_åX,ësX,yòX,ø]X,càX,ælX,rúX,LX,RUX,êãg,éYg,_åg,ësg,yòg,ø]g,càg,ælg,rúg,Lg,RUg,Xdg,glg,®jv,psv,®j…,ps…,v‚…,…Š…,Xã¥.éY¥._å¥.ës¥.yò¥.ø]¥.cà¥.æl¥.rú¥.L¥.Rj¥.p¢¥.Xãª0éYª0_åª0ësª0yòª0ø]ª0càª0ælª0rúª0Lª0Rjª0p¢ª0Xã    %,éY    %,_å    %,ës    %,yò    %,ø]    %,cà    %,æl    %,rú    %,L    %,Rj    %,p¢    %,¥    "    %,    %    *    %,ìF:    Pêë    Pòó    Pô¸    Põö    P÷ø    Pùú    P ¸    P56    Pû    Pû        P"û
    P'û     P)û     P9û     PGû    PIû    POû    PWû    PYû    Psû    Püý    Pþÿ    P    P    P¸    P    P¸    P    P¸    P        P
¸    P     P ¸     P !    P¸"    P#    P¸$    P%    P¸&    P'    P¸(    P)    P¸*    P¸+    P,    P-    P¸.    P/    P0    P¸1    P 2    P!3    P"¸4    P#$5    P%&6    P'7    P(8    P)¸9**Š|ƒ€¨Í‚ì„õ„õ„ì„ì„… … … ……………;†>†>†2†2†`‰i‰i‰i‰`‰`‰ Š¯Š¯ŠËŠËŠŒŒ'6dvv‹­­­­­­F’,’,’ü’ô‘'q”w”¦•¸•¸•ˆ•q”ý——4˜F˜F˜˜ý—³ÅÅ•00lžrž¡Ÿ³Ÿ³ŸƒŸlžø¡þ¡-¢?¢?¢¢ø¡„¤Š¤»¥Í¥Í¥¥„¤›Œ„ŠŸ®Â¯Ë¯Ë¯Â¯Â¯ã°ç°ç°Ú°Ú° ±±±±±9³6³6³A³5³5³5³®è·ë·ë·ß·ß·    ¸    ¸    ¸ú¸ú¸Kˆ    >¼    >¼    >¼1íöØŸ¸¥³§ÿ¸¥³g¸¥³i½ÀYS³Ÿ»¾Y ½zY±SY¶SYÀSY¼SYÂSYÄSYÆSYÈSYÊSY    ÌSY
ÎSY ½zY»¾Y½zYÐSYÒSYÔSY<SYÖSYØS·ÛSY»¾Y½zYÐSYÝSYÔSY<SYÖSYØS·ÛSY»¾Y½zYÐSYßSYÔSY<SYÖSYØS·ÛSY»¾Y½zYÐSYáSYãSYRSYÔSY<SYÖSYåS·ÛSY»¾Y½zYÐSYçSYãSYRSYÔSY<SYÖSYåS·ÛSY»¾Y½zYÐSYéSYãSYRSYÔSY<SYÖSYåS·ÛSS·Û³º±ì Øêë23í"¶°ì êë43í"¼°ì êë5äí ¬ì êë67í"²º°ì êë